An autonomously healable, highly stretchable and cyclically compressible, wearable hydrogel as a multimodal sensor

Abstract

Fe3+/PVAA-PAM hydrogels show highly stretchable, self-healing properties and can be used as artificial ionic skin for directly monitoring human motion.
